LUCKNOW, Aug. 8 -- Bahujan Samaj Party (BSP) president Mayawati on Saturday hit out at Samajwadi Party (SP) chief Akhilesh Yadav over his recent remarks that the 'P' in the party's PDA formula could also stand for Pandit, alleging that the SP was changing its political narrative to woo Brahmin voters.

In a post on X, Mayawati accused the SP of changing its political stance according to electoral requirements and said the party was "changing colours like a chameleon" as it pursued what she termed narrow caste-based politics.
